3rd party rights, overriding interests an register of title
  1. 3rd party rights
    1. 2 b protected must be of ways in LRA 2002
      1. Notice (on register)
        1. LRA2002 s32
          1. restrictive covs
            1. easements
              1. right of occupation under fam law act 1996
                1. lease affecting reversionary title
                  1. changin orders against sole propreitor
                    1. Can be agreed or unilateral notice
                    2. Overridding interest (not on register)
                      1. overlap btwn ORs of 1st reg and Reg disps
                        1. Most common examples are...
                          1. leases of 7 years or less
                            1. interest of pers occupying land
                              1. unless person failed to disclose when asked- not OR interest where buyer had no knowledge on reasonable careful inspection of land
                              2. legal easements or profits
                            2. Restrictions
                              1. Regulates circumstances in which disposition of reg estate or charge may be subject of an entry in register
                                1. to ensure purchase monies paid to at least 2 trustees or trust corp in order to overreach in interests
                                  1. e.g owners at tenants in common
                                  2. show any limitation on powers of a corp or oth body
                                    1. ensure any necessary consents of disposition are obtained
                              2. Register of Title
                                1. s66 LRA - allows anyone to inspect or copy reg
                                  1. s67 anyone can apply to make copies
                                    1. 3 parts of reg
                                      1. property register
                                        1. provides description of prop inc statment of estate -F'hold/ L'hold
                                          1. if L'hold, inc date of L, term, parties and start date
                                          2. rights of way and easements that benefit prop
                                            1. ref mad to title plan, which shows location and general boundary
                                            2. proprietorship register
                                              1. includes class of Title
                                                1. name and address of prop'ter
                                                  1. Notices and restrictions
                                                  2. Charges Register
                                                    1. list of charges affecting property in order of priority
                                                      1. adverse interests inc restrictiv covs to which prop subject
                                                        1. leases with no OR interests for superior title
